Understanding Anomaly Detection: The AI Revolution
Anomaly detection in network traffic isn't new, but the integration of AI has revolutionized the field. Traditional methods relied heavily on signature-based detection, which is akin to recognizing a known enemy in a lineup. However, AI takes a more proactive approach, identifying unusual patterns that deviate from the norm—even if those patterns have never been encountered before. Imagine AI as a vigilant guard who can spot a suspicious character in a crowd, regardless of whether they've been seen before.

# Predictive Maintenance in Industrial Networks
One of the most compelling applications of anomaly detection is in industrial networks. In manufacturing plants, any disruption can lead to significant downtime and financial loss. By deploying AI-driven anomaly detection, industrial networks can predict and prevent potential failures before they occur. For instance, a sudden spike in data traffic between a machine and a control center might indicate a malfunction or an attempted hack. AI can flag these anomalies, allowing for immediate intervention and preventing costly shutdowns.
# Securing E-commerce Platforms
E-commerce platforms are prime targets for cyber-attacks due to the sensitive data they handle. Anomaly detection AI can monitor user behavior, identifying unusual activities such as multiple failed login attempts or unusual purchase patterns. For example, if a user suddenly starts making high-value transactions from an unfamiliar location, the system can trigger an alert, prompting further verification and potentially thwarting a fraudulent transaction.
